The work is registered in the catalogue raisonné of the paintings of Josef Albers as 1960.1.54.
“We are able to hear a single tone, but we almost never (that is, without special devices) see a single color unconnected and unrelated to other colors. Colors present themselves in continuous flux, constantly related to changing neighbors and changing conditions. As a consequence, this proves for the reading of color what Kandinsky often demanded for the reading of art: what counts is not the what but the how.” — Josef Albers
